CURA-1923: SliceInfo: Sending data threaded

The idea is to make the sending process, so it won't block the UI until the data is sent or the timeout has reached.
This commit does the following:
* Increasing the timeout to 5s
-> As we are sending our data threaded now this won't hurt. At least for clients in slow networks.
* Moving section for "sending data to info_url" into a seperate thread.
* Starting the thread instead and collecting all threads in a list
* Removing all threads from the list, if they have already finished their work.
* When the SliceInfo Extension gets __del__'d, it will wait for the threads until they finish.

Contributes to CURA-1923

class SliceInfoThread(Thread):
data = None
url = None
def __init__(self, url, data):
Thread.__init__(self)
self.url = url
self.data = data
def run(self):
if not self.url or not self.data:
Logger.log("e", "URL or DATA for sending slice info was not set!")
# Submit data
kwoptions = {"data" : self.data,
"timeout" : 5
}
if Platform.isOSX():
kwoptions["context"] = ssl._create_unverified_context()
try:
f = urllib.request.urlopen(self.url, **kwoptions)
Logger.log("i", "Sent anonymous slice info to %s", self.url)
f.close()
except Exception:
Logger.logException("e", "An exception occurred while trying to send slice information")
